Star appoints Kiyawat as VP sales, dist SE Asia
Star yesterday announced the appointment of Gautam Kiyawat as vice president ad sales and distribution for Singapore, Hong Kong, Malaysia and Indonesia.

Lodestar Media bags Sapat Group's media duties
Lodestar Media has won the Rs 50 million media duties of the Sapat Group of Companies. The company has diversified businesses in tea, pharmaceuticals, real estate and information technology.
